When the whole city was mad enough, Joker planned to put everyone in Gotham City under his mind control by launching the AntiGlow into space with a giant Joker rocket. He placed the Anti-Glow between the teeth of the rocket's Joker face. Jr. was excited about seeing the remote and asked if he could push the button when it was time. Joker told him to be patient. As the Bat-Family fought Livewire, Solomon Grundy, Mad Hatter, and Killer Croc, Jr. liked all the buttons on the remote and asked if "GF" stood for "grand finale." He demonstrated it was for "giant fart" then pointed out the skull and crossbones was for the grand finale. He tried to push it but Joker stopped him and reminded him they had to make sure Gotham was primed and ready first. Joker surveyed the city and declared it was showtime. Batman made his way to Joker and demanded the remote. Joker warned him not to take another step or he would activate the AntiGlow. Batman asked Jr. for help and apologized for not trusting him.
Batman told Jr. to think of Gotham. Joker teased him with touching the button. Joker mocked Batman. Batman asked Jr. not to make Gotham pay for his mistake. Jr. asked him if he did make a mistake. Batman admitted to it. The rest of the Bat-Fam arrived. Jr. pointed out he didn't think he could handle the AntiGlow mission and he should have trusted that he could. Batman agreed. Jr. asked if he would trust him to handle it if he could go back in time. Batman stated he would. Jr. asked for the remote. Jr. proclaimed April Fools to his dad. Joker blew a raspberry at Batman. Jr. clarified he was talking to Joker. He pushed the button that caused the rocket to self-destruct. Batman fired a grapnel line and set Little Batman up with it. Little Batman threw out a Batarang that destroyed the AntiGlow.
